Output 31d6f2090f7ae26098bf14f2d501d39784fc02680f3c343e49e84a1b5db57c74:1

value
43129991
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84e4fb7d0d5b70c7dc3fb390444b699a1ccca7e6 OP_EQUAL
address
ML1qjj5RmvHVdN27cdqpNFXrm8xALAjBAz
transaction
31d6f2090f7ae26098bf14f2d501d39784fc02680f3c343e49e84a1b5db57c74
spent
true